Recipe: Chicken Stew in a Bread Bowl




Have you ever had Chicken Stew in a Bread Bowl? Tim Horton's used to carry it and it was a real treat. When they quit making it, my family and I were really disappointed. Recently, I was in a bakery that sells soup/stew bread bowls. I decided I'd give it a try and we love it. If you can't find bread bowls, use extra large buns or small bread loaves.


Ingredients:
2 or 3 boneless chicken breasts, cut into bite size pieces
2 cups cubed potatoes
1/2 cup sliced carrots
1/4 cup chopped onion
1/4 cup chopped celery
1/2 tsp. salt
1/4 tsp. pepper
1/8 tsp. garlic powder
1/2 tsp. parsley flakes
Water
Flour


How to make this recipe:
Brown chicken breasts in a cast iron pan. Add vegetables. Add enough water to cover chicken and vegetables. Add seasoning. Bring to a boil and cook until vegetables are soft. Make sure to stir enough to scrape the "brown" off the bottom of the pan (that's what makes great gravy!)
Whisk 4 tbs. of flour with a cup of water and add to pan. Turn up the heat and stir until it boils and thickens (add more flour/water if necessary).

Cut out the center of the bread bowls and fill with stew.

NOTE: I always decide how much meat and vegetables to use by how many people will be eating and how much they eat!
